More than 11,000 alien species have been documented by DAISIE (Delivering Alien Invasive Species Inventory for Europe), a unique three year research project with more than 100 European scientists, funded by the European Union that provides new knowledge on biological invasions in Europe. Biological invasions by alien species often result in a significant loss in the economic value, biological diversity and function of invaded ecosystems.
University of Alberta research has yielded a way to double the output of rice crops in some of the world's poorest, most distressed areas.
Jerome Bernier, a PhD student in the U of A Department of Agricultural, Food and Nutritional Science, has found a group of genes in rice that enables a yield of up to 100 per cent more in severe drought conditions.
The discovery marks the first time this group of genes in rice has been identified, and could potentially bring relief to farmers in countries like India and Thailand, where rice crops are regularly faced with drought. Rice is the number one crop consumed by humans annually.
To some, it's a vague remembrance of a scene from a past life. Others attribute it to viewing something in real life they dreamed the night before. To the leather-clad protagonists of the movie "The Matrix", it happened whenever the machines altered something about the virtual world they created. Regardless of the explanation, déjà vu is the common and unmistakable experience of feeling as if whatever sensory input we're receiving has been received before - even though we can't pinpoint the exact source.

The explosion of a binary star inside a
planetary nebula has been captured by a team of researchers – an event that has not been witnessed for more than 100 years. The study, published in
Astrophysical Journal Letters, predicts that the combined mass of the two stars in the system may be high enough for the stars to eventually spiral into each other, triggering an even larger supernova explosion.
Scientists are reporting the first genome-wide sequence of an extinct animal, according to Webb Miller, Penn State professor of biology, one of the project's two leaders. The animal is the woolly mammoth, an extinct species of elephant that was adapted to living in the cold environment of the northern hemisphere and they did it by sequencing four billion DNA bases using next-generation DNA-sequencing instruments and a novel approach that reads ancient DNA with high efficiency.
A ban on fast food advertisements in the United States could reduce the number of overweight children by as much as 18 percent, according to a new study being published this month in the Journal of Law and Economics. The study also reports that eliminating the tax deductibility associated with television advertising would result in a reduction of childhood obesity, though in smaller numbers.
The authors found that a ban on fast food television advertisements during children's programming would reduce the number of overweight children ages 3-11 by 18 percent, while also lowering the number of overweight adolescents ages 12-18 by 14 percent. The effect is more pronounced for males than females.
A detailed analysis of black carbon, the residue of burned organic matter, in computer climate models suggests they may be overestimating global warming predictions. A new Cornell study in Nature Geosciences quantified the amount of black carbon in Australian soils and found that there was far more than expected, said Johannes Lehmann, the paper's lead author and a Cornell professor of biogeochemistry. The survey was the largest of black carbon ever published.
Analysis of newly revealed items found at the site of what is believed to be the mausoleum of King Herod at Herodium (Herodion in Greek) have provided Hebrew University of Jerusalem archaeological researchers with more evidence affirming that this was indeed the site of the famed ruler's 1st century B.C.E. grave.
Herod was the Roman-appointed king of Judea from 37 to 4 B.C.E., who was renowned for his many monumental building projects, including the reconstruction of the Temple in Jerusalem, the palace at Masada, the harbor and city of Caesarea, as well as the palatial complex at Herodium, 15 kilometers south of Jerusalem.
The first tissue-engineered trachea (windpipe), utilizing the patient's own stem cells, has been successfully transplanted into a young woman with a failing airway. The bioengineered trachea immediately provided the patient with a normally functioning airway, thereby saving her life.
These remarkable results provide crucial new evidence that
adult stem cells, combined with biologically compatible materials, can offer genuine solutions to other serious illnesses.
Global land use patterns and increasing pressures on water resources demand creative urban stormwater management. Traditional stormwater management focuses on regulating the flow of runoff to waterways, but generally does little to restore the
hydrologic cycle disrupted by extensive pavement and compacted urban soils with low permeability. The lack of infiltration opportunities affects groundwater recharge and has negative repercussions on water quality downstream.
